A single-light triggered and dual-imaging guided multifunctional platform for combined photothermal and photodynamic therapy based on TD-controlled and ICG-loaded CuS@mSiO2.

Qing You1, Qi Sun1, Jinping Wang1, Xiaoxiao Tan1, Xiaojuan Pang1, Li Liu1, Meng Yu1, Fengping Tan1, Nan Li1.   

Abstract

Near-infrared (NIR)-responsive drug delivery systems have received enormous attention because of their good biocompatibility and high biological penetration. In this work, we report a novel 1-tetradecanol (TD)-controlled and indocyanine green (ICG)-loaded CuS@mSiO2 phototherapy nanoplatform (CuS@mSiO2-TD/ICG). The CuS@mSiO2 nanoparticles prepared by a facile one-pot approach can serve as drug-delivery vehicles to transport the NIR absorbing phototherapeutic agent (ICG) within the mesoporous cavities. Meanwhile a phase-change molecule (PCM), TD, is introduced as a thermosensitive gatekeeper to avoid the premature release of loaded ICG. Noticeably, the combined therapy is irradiated at an 808 nm single-light wavelength, thus performing the photothermal therapy (PTT) based on CuS@mSiO2 as well as simultaneously triggering the photodynamic (PDT)/PTT effect based on ICG. Furthermore, ICG also has the function of dual in vivo fluorescence imaging and photoacoustic (PA) imaging. This dual imaging-guided and gatekeeper-controlled nanoplatform for the single-light triggered PTT/PDT treatment holds significant promise for future cancer therapy due to their markedly improved therapeutic efficacy and decreased systemic toxicity.
